Summary
Breeding ducks were studied from 1977-81 on the Grand River Marsh Wildlife Area (GRM) and the Grand River Extensive Area (GREA), a 50-mile square block of land surrounding the GRM. The 2,500-mile² study area includes parts of Adams, Columbia, Dodge, Fond du Lac, Green Lake, Marquette, Sauk, Waushara and Winnebago counties in southeastern Wisconsin.
